Prefetcher logic looks fine, but don't bury these numbers in the loop. The Tilecask prefetch radius and eviction thresholds interact badly if changed independently — we learned that during the Ostermont rollout. Pull them into one block so future maintainers see the coupling. Also add a comment pointing at the bandwidth ceiling. Keep them together exactly as shown here.

limits module of tafop-hahop:
WEIGHTS = {
    "julmir": 223,
    "belox": 987,
    "lamion": 470,
    "pelath": 609,
    "fraok": 1010,
    "eliion": 343,
    "drudor": 342,
}

Internal Memo — Budget Request

To the sales leads: Operations has submitted a budget request to fund two additional demo kits for the Vellane product line and travel support for the Ashgrove territory push. Finance expects a decision within two weeks. No changes to current spending limits until then; log any urgent needs with your regional coordinator. Background on the request's purpose appears below.

board note of fahaf-fadug: Gilixax Logistics is in early talks to buy Praiusax Partners for about $8.1 million. The Pramir launch date is September 23, and nothing goes to the press before then.

## Onboarding: Farebranch Rules Engine

Plugin authors integrate with Farebranch by registering fee rules against the evaluation API. Rules are sandboxed; they cannot perform network calls directly. All rate-table lookups go through the host, which validates your plugin manifest at load time. Your local env file must include the signing credential the host uses to verify manifests, set on the next line.

secret setting of bajef-fajof: COURIER_KEY3=76c

**Mgmt Meeting Minutes — Retiring the Brightline Range**

Quick recap for sales leads at Fenholt Supplies: we agreed to retire the Brightline fixture range by year-end. Remaining stock moves to clearance pricing next month, and accounts on standing orders get migrated to the Lumetta range. Trade-in incentives were approved in principle. The confidential note on next steps sits just below.

board note of bajof-bajeg: The pricing group signed off on a budget of $13.4 million for Project Sildor. The renewal with Lamixek Holdings closes at $48.9 million a year, 49 percent above the last contract.